Output 2e8be815fc71d6b619e452dc5ded442fbe89ed228262450b5bda2c430abfb01d:5

value
624087
script pubkey
OP_0 OP_PUSHBYTES_20 a580bf9df67d798beb90b7a834f228cf47216605
address
bc1q5kqtl80k04uch6usk75rfu3gearjzes90mvfh3
transaction
2e8be815fc71d6b619e452dc5ded442fbe89ed228262450b5bda2c430abfb01d
confirmations
201258
spent
true